Output 2ec8351067be4f3b8575bd427ac17f1cf3a7e9bb48a4046f8e00f086f0181607:4

value
33892911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ad18b850ac08b397f2f12b18be04e458e8fe24fa OP_EQUAL
address
3HUGSJdcezNZDCSXGqb9yP2fm5zdvKZ2x7
transaction
2ec8351067be4f3b8575bd427ac17f1cf3a7e9bb48a4046f8e00f086f0181607
spent
true